(design project from last semester)
Prompt:
‘Starting from an object of your choice, craft a story for the object and examine how different mediums and materials play into communication. Using the original object, create a record cover for a musical artist. Consider how the medium and form will represent the identity of the music or artist.’
I chose Sigur Rós and an enamelware pitcher
‘Sigur Rós, a band hailing from Reykjavík, Iceland, use their native language for its parts. Paying little mind to grammatical structure, they string together words and phrases to create an audial composition. The pitcher went through the same process of being “scrapped for parts,” broken down into three different materials/textures: metal, porcelain/enamel, and water. These were then used to create different compositions.’

(Damn / Tower of Destruction) 2014
Though it deviates in imagery between different tarot decks, the Tower always signifies disaster, upheaval, and revelation – and the change and growth that is the result. These ideas are represented by the titular tower, set upon by heavenly destruction – often lightening or fire. Figure(s) fall from the ruined tower, their place disrupted by this sudden change. The card speaks about the change caused by sudden revelation or catastrophe, the destruction of old philosophies to make room for the new. Reversed, the Tower indicates fear of change and being trapped by holding onto old beliefs – the inability to move forward. I think the moment where those things meet but have yet to switch – where the revelation has occurred, awareness has been reached, ignorance lost, but the individual is not yet ready to move forward and leave the destroyed tower – is perhaps the thing most worthy of examination.
